Core: The Debugging — Comparing Architectures Under Hood
Let’s crack open the two codebases. Ethereum’s architecture is a compound of compromises: the Ethereum Virtual Machine (EVM) is a deterministic state machine that serializes transactions, while the Beacon Chain introduces sharded data availability. The result is a modular design that requires Layer2s to handle execution—effectively outsourcing speed to third parties. Solana, by contrast, uses a single global state machine with parallel transaction processing via Sealevel. Its Proof of History (PoH) timestamp mechanism creates a cryptographic clock that allows non-deterministic optimizations. This isn’t just academic: in stress tests, Solana’s mainnet processes 2,500 transactions per second (TPS) consistently, with burst capability of 10,000 TPS. Ethereum’s base layer averages 15 TPS, with Layer2s like Arbitrum peaking at 4,000 TPS—but those transactions settle on Ethereum after a delay. The gap is real.

Let’s talk about revenue models. Ethereum’s primary income is transaction fees, which burned 1.2 million ETH in the last year (roughly $3.8 billion at current prices). Solana’s fee burn is about $180 million—a fraction. The disconnect is that Solana’s market cap overtakes Ethereum despite earning 20x less in fees. Why? Because investors are betting on future usage, not current revenue. That’s a speculative premium.
